cchalogamer Posted July 21, 2015 Posted July 21, 2015 (edited) Unless something's changed in the last few revisions of Nvidia's drivers PhysX is disabled when running with an AMD card in the system. For example 290X + 750Ti = PhysX disabled for the 750 Ti. Worked the same way with two GTX 770s in SLI and an older AMD card in the system for running extra monitors. Again there's a chance they removed this block, but knowing Nvidia's record I doubt it. As a side note the 210 would have a hard time doing PhysX if it even supports the technology (nvidia only shows the 240 or higher as supporting it).
